Notice and Application. When a vacancy occurs, all Employees shall be notified of the opening and given an opportunity to apply. All openings (including new positions) shall be posted in the school building or work site for five (5) days before being opened to outside applicants. A maximum of two (2) internal moves may be made before a job is posted externally. In the summer, notice will be mailed to employees with transfer requests on file with the District before being opened to outside applicants. Postings of less than five (5) days will occur only in extenuating circumstances and after the District has notified the President of the Association of the need.

Notice and Application. Notice of all new jobs and job vacancies within the bargaining unit shall be posted on employee bulletin boards in each building for four (4) workdays, provided, however, that when school is not in session, notice of an opening shall be given to the President of the local unit and provided further that the Employer shall not be required to post more than two (2) successive vacancies caused by the transfer of an employee to a different position, including the posting of the initial vacancy. Any bargaining unit employee shall have the right to make application in writing for any such position within the posting period except that an employee shall not be eligible by right to receive more than one (1) opening within any one school year. A bargaining unit employee who has been displaced will be able to receive no more than two openings within any one school year. The displacement is one of the two openings.

Notice and Application. The Bank shall provide notice in the Company’s account applications to the Company’s prospective account holders that information is being requested to verify their identity in order to combat money laundering and terrorist financing. The Company account applications shall request, at a minimum, the following information with respect to each account holder, or such other information as is required pursuant to the CIP Rule: (i) name, (ii) date of birth for an individual (iii) residential address for individuals and address for principal place of business for a legal entity, and (iv) taxpayer identification number for a U.S. person or appropriate identification number or information for a non-U.S. person.
Notice and Application. When a Member plans to take leave under this policy, the Member must give the City thirty (30) days notice. If it is not possible to give thirty days’ notice, the Member must give as much notice as is practicable - normally no later than twenty- four (24) hours after the need for leave is known. A Member undergoing planned medical treatment is required to make a reasonable effort to schedule the treatment to minimize disruptions to the City's operations. If a Member fails to provide thirty (30) days notice for foreseeable leave with no reasonable excuse for the delay, the leave request may be denied until at least thirty (30) days from the date the employer receives notice. While on leave, Members are requested to report periodically to the City regarding the status of their medical condition, and their intent to return to work. Members shall provide at least verbal notice sufficient to make the City aware that the Member needs FMLA-qualifying leave, the anticipated timing and duration of the leave. The City may inquire further of the Member if it is necessary to have more information about whether FMLA leave is to be taken. Except when the leave is not foreseeable, all Members requesting leave under this policy must submit the request in writing to their immediate supervisor, with a copy to the Personnel Department. If a Member takes leave based on the serious health condition of the Member or to care for a family member, the Member must make a reasonable effort to schedule treatment as to not unduly disrupt the City's operations.

Notice and Application. The Borrower shall give notice to the Agent of the proposed issuance of the Letter of Credit on a Business Day which is at least three Business Days (or such lesser number of days as the Agent shall agree in its sole discretion) prior to the proposed date of issuance of the Letter of Credit. Each such notice shall be accompanied by a letter of credit application in form satisfactory to the Agent and be duly executed by the Borrower. So long as the Agent has not received written notice that the conditions precedent set forth in Section 4.2 with respect to the issuance of such Letter of Credit have not been satisfied, the Agent shall issue the Letter of Credit on the requested issuance date.
